The applicant needs to demonstrate the three leadership requirements of:
- vision and values
- knowledge and understanding
- personal qualities, social and interpersonal skills
- as enacted through the five professional practices particular to the role of a principal identified by the Australian Professional Standard for Principals:
- Effective leadership in teaching and learning
- Developing self and others
- Leading improvement, innovation and change
- Leading the management of the school
- Engaging and working with the community

Port Hedland is approximately 1700kms from Perth and has a culturally diverse population, spread between two centres about 20 kms apart. South Hedland has a population of just over 9000 and Port Hedland over 5000. Hedland Senior High School is situated in South Hedland and attracts students from five primary schools; Baler, Cassia, Port Hedland, South Hedland and St Cecelia’s (a private school). While student enrolments have been over 800 for the past 4 years, the transient nature of work in the mining industry means there is a significant turnover of students during the year.
